Located in the misty Palani Hills of Tamil Nadu, India, Kodaikanal International School (KIS) is more than just a school; it’s a calling. Founded in 1901 as HighClerc School, this Pre-K to Grade 12 residential IB World School fuses over a century of academic excellence with transformative outdoor learning and a deep commitment to international education.
KIS made history in 1975 as the first school in India to offer the IB Diploma Programme, and today, it stands proudly as one of the few fully IB continuum residential schools in the country; authorized to offer the Primary Years, Middle Years, Diploma, and Career-related IB Programmes. Students graduate with both the IB and the KIS Diploma. The school is accredited by the Middle States Association (MSA) and recognized by the Association of Indian Universities, opening doors to top universities around the world.
KIS operates on two academic campuses, Ganga (Pre-K to Grade 8) and HighClerc (Grades 9 to 12). Both feature modern classrooms, science and computer labs, libraries, and sports facilities.
KIS’s international student body of 500 learners represents 16 nations, fostering a rich multicultural environment. While approximately 76% of the students and 69% of the teaching staff are from India, the school thrives on diversity and global perspectives.
Outdoor education is at the heart of the KIS experience. Its dedicated 135-acre Poondi campsite allows students to engage deeply with nature. Whether they are canoeing on the lake, climbing the professional wall, hiking 80 miles over the hills, or simply bonding around a campfire, students learn life skills, resilience, and environmental stewardship in unforgettable ways.
Student residences at KIS are home-like and welcoming, with 16 cozy houses spread across four campuses. Each residence is cared for by a residential parent and designed to foster a sense of belonging and safety. Rooms are shared by no more than three students, encouraging both community and personal space.
The international teaching benefits package includes furnished housing, utilities, annual airfare for a family of four, health insurance with personal accident coverage, and professional development opportunities. Tuition for staff children is waived, and school-related activities, programs, and meals are subsidized.
KIS welcomes applications from diverse, certified educators—including married teaching couples, teachers with a non-teaching spouse, newly certified teachers, and interns seeking overseas teaching experience. Teachers must hold a degree in the subject they teach, and current Indian visa regulations permit certified teachers under the age of 60.
